Overview
In a peaceful rural location but still easy to reach from the M4, The Vineyard is a wine-lover’s haven, with an impressive 30,000-bottle wine cellar, including wines from the award-winning estate of owner Sir Peter Michael. Comfortable lounges lead into the stylish restaurant, and thence to The Tasting Room, a smaller space with just 28 covers. Richly decorated in tones of chocolate, bronze and gold, you can expect a ‘sensory journey’ as you explore the seasonal multi-course tasting menu. This is modern British cooking with some Californian influences, and wine is as much a part of the experience as the food.

About the area
Berkshire consists of two distinct parts: the western half, which is predominantly rural, with the Lambourn Downs spilling down to the River Lambourn and the Berkshire Downs to the majestic Thames, and the eastern half of Berkshire, which offers plenty of opportunity to get out and savour open spaces. Reading and Newbury are the county’s major towns, and the River Kennet flows through them both
